Fast Dredge decks are something I thought would be pretty good in this Delver/Pile infested meta that relies heavily on DRS plus Surgical as gravehate. Evidently somebody else agreed with this take, and did well for themselves.

Well, now that the top 2 decks in the format both eschew basics almost entirely, Dragon Stompy is looking at an all-you-can-eat buffet. More or less resolve a spell > win. Of course, it's still a high variance deck that doesn't tend to perform very reliably over the course of a long tournament but here we can see what it can do if it gets there.

Speaking for myself, Champion is an ace. It's basicly your own TNN. I have them in my build and have come to love them. It's great to sac your Ravager knowing the target the counters are going to land on can't be removed in response, can block a Batterskull without giving life or punch past an opponents TNN.
